Dating Confidence Reset: Clear Goals, Calm Pace, Better Matches
Start by getting clear about what you want. List the top three things that matter most to you—values, deal-breakers, and the kind of connection you hope for. When your intentions are specific, it’s easier to spot matches that deserve your time and to let go of interactions that don’t.
Slow down the process. Treat early chats like brief interviews rather than make-or-break exams. Ask a couple of meaningful questions, share one honest detail about yourself, and see how the other person responds over a few messages. Healthy pacing gives you space to notice compatibility without burning out.
Set realistic expectations. Online conversations often take time to reveal whether there’s genuine chemistry. Expect some dead-ends and short chats—that’s normal. Instead of measuring success by response rate or the number of matches, track small wins: a thoughtful reply, a shared laugh, or a clear plan to meet.
Keep emotional steadiness by creating simple boundaries. Decide in advance how many new conversations you’ll maintain at once, how long you’ll give a chat to develop, and when you’ll pause swiping or messaging to recharge. Boundaries protect your energy and help you show up more confidently.
Choose quality over quantity. When evaluating someone new, look for a few signs that matter to you—consistent replies, curiosity about your life, or alignment on key values—rather than relying on vague impressions. Focusing your time on better prospects reduces the numbers-game mentality and increases meaningful interactions.
Notice progress even when it’s small. Keep a private note of things that went well: a smoother conversation, clearer communication, or a boundary you upheld. Those notes remind you that dating is a skill you can improve and that patience pays off.
Finally, be kind to yourself. Feeling tired or discouraged is a normal part of dating. Take breaks when you need them, reset your goals, and return with a clear plan.
